Subject: Handover — validator plugin stuff

Hey Priya,

Passing you the baton on Checkwright, our plugin system for data validators. The new schema-drift plugin shipped Tuesday and mostly behaves, but it occasionally flags empty CSV uploads as "malformed" — harmless, just noisy. I've muted the alert until Friday. If support escalates anything about plugin load failures, the fix is usually bumping the registry cache. Questions after I'm off? Reach the Checkwright maintainers at the address below.

billing contact of hawip-kahif = zorwyn@tolvaqlabs.corp

Subject: CrashLadle cut-over complete

Hi — summarizing yesterday's migration of the CrashLadle mobile crash-report pipeline from the old Fennwick cluster to the new ingest tier. Symbol upload, retention trimming, and the dedupe stage all moved without data loss; we ran dual-write for six hours and diffed outputs before flipping DNS. Old ingest endpoints were disabled this morning. For your review, note that TLS termination now happens at the edge proxy. The effective service configuration is as follows.

service settings:
[casax]
port = 6379
team = rusir
host = casax.zemvarhq.corp
region = outer-4
access_code = ac_9808ce
timeout_ms = 1500

ONBOARDING — Lintbarrow SQL rules. All .sql files run through sqlfence pre-commit: uppercase keywords, no SELECT *, explicit JOINs, trailing semicolons required. Migrations under db/migrations are also checked for reversibility. CI mirrors the local hook; don't skip it. The linter fetches the shared ruleset from our internal registry, which needs an auth token before first run. On a fresh on-call laptop, add this line to your local env file:

env line for fafof-fahag: LEDGER_TOKEN5=f8790